Course Summary

The Department of Theology & Religious Studies offers a wide-ranging perspective on the phenomenon of religion, and Christianity in particular. It does so by drawing on a great number of sub-disciplines, such as philosophy, history, literary criticism, sociology, the study of art, and so forth.

Theology & Religious Studies at MIC covers a wide range of topics including world religions, the world of the Bible, Christology, moral theology and critical issues in modern religion.

The Student

Career Interests

This course is typically suited for people with the following Career Interests. If these interests do not describe you, this course may prepare you for work you may not find satisfying.

Social

The Social person's interests focus on interacting with the people in their environment. In all cases, the Social person enjoys the personal contact with other people in preference to the impersonal dealings with things, data and ideas found in other groups.

Many will seek out positions where there is direct contact with the public in some advisory role, whether a receptionist or a counsellor. Social people are motivated by an interest in different types of people and like diversity in their work environments. Many are drawn towards careers in the caring professions and social welfare area, whilst others prefer teaching and other 'informing' roles.

Career Progression

Theology & Religious Studies graduates find work in a wide range of careers, including: Teaching, Further/Higher education, Law, Social Care, Pastoral and Chaplaincy work, Community work, Development work, Voluntary/Charity management and co-ordination, Guidance and counselling, and Youth work.
